A Clay County Bicentennial endorsement includes:

  • Your project, program, or event posted on the Clay County website calendar.
  • Permission to use the Clay County Bicentennial logo.
  • Promotion on any Clay County Tourism and/or other social media platforms.
  • Event listing in the official Bicentennial program/booklet

 

Endorsement Criteria

To be considered for a Clay County Bicentennial Commission endorsement, the applicant must show that the proposed project, program, or event meets the criteria outlined below.

  • Relevant to the mission to advise the Clay County Commission on Bicentennial specific celebrations and to further efforts to honor Clay County, its rich history and heritage.
  • Open to the public and as accessible as practical.
  • Funding and operations of the project, program, or event are self-supporting.

 

APPLICATION PROCESS

Applications may be submitted electronically using the form below.

Applications will be reviewed on the fifteenth of every month, with endorsed projects, programs, and events announced by the fifteenth of the following month. If additional time for review is needed, the applicant will be notified. Approval or denial of any application will be made at the discretion of the Clay County Bicentennial Commission from the recommendation of the Clay County Bicentennial Commission’s Events Sub-committee.

MISSION

The purpose of this Commission shall be to advise the County Commission on bicentennial celebrations and to further efforts to honor Clay County, its rich history and heritage. 

The Clay County Bicentennial Commission shall also work in conjunction with other interested parties to promote this occasion.

The Clay County Bicentennial Commission shall be comprised of eleven member residing in Clay County and shall be consistent with county bylaws and ordinances. Each member shall be appointed under the provision of the Clay County Constitution, to a two-year term to commence upon approval of the Clay County Commission.
